Transaction 6664a96c1120595416d1b969e25c2c9c2064c53b8d2fdbb712ee19e3921f80a3

1 Input
2 Outputs
  • 6664a96c1120595416d1b969e25c2c9c2064c53b8d2fdbb712ee19e3921f80a3:0
  • value  1636380
    address  3BgJojcWw6uCg8mheioT8kahna19toF4Vn
  • 6664a96c1120595416d1b969e25c2c9c2064c53b8d2fdbb712ee19e3921f80a3:1
  • value  69023043
    address  34SJ3WFpGYs3sWLWkxjNJu5h7sPL6CwHw1